BAGAKHANGAI–KHUNNU CITY BRANCH RAILWAY PROJECT REACHES 90% COMPLETION
The Bagakhangai–Khunnu City branch railway project, aimed at centrally distributing goods from the cargo terminal in the Khushig Valley and Orgog Mountain area and establishing logistics infrastructure, is being implemented according to plan. As of today, construction works under Phase I of the project are approximately 90% complete.
The project includes the construction of a third-class railway line with a total length of 102.8 km and a 1,520 mm gauge, comprising 3 stations, 4 passing loops, and 2.5 km of bridge structures. Once commissioned, the branch railway will enable freight flows to bypass the city center and be organized through satellite cities and logistics zones, forming a core foundation of Ulaanbaatar’s freight transport infrastructure.
Construction is planned to be carried out in two phases. Phase I covers 87.85 km from Bagakhangai Station to Khushig Valley Station, while Phase II will implement the remaining 14.95 km of railway construction.
